(Almost) Unbreakable Bubbles

Tags: ,
Little girl blowing almost unbreakable bubbles

 

Tired of bubbles that pop as soon as you blow them? Try this recipe for (almost) unbreakable bubbles! It’s possible to break these bubbles, but they are stronger than regular soap bubbles. 

Supplies:

  • 3 cups of water
  • 1 cup liquid dish washing detergent
  • 1/2 cup white corn syrup 

Stir the ingredients together; creating an everlasting bubble and adding food coloring to the mix will make the bubbles different colors. Best to use them outside – less mess!
